What Yoga Does for Your Body

Yoga is unique in that it helps shape the body using only your own body weight. This natural approach is great for building lean muscles, increasing flexibility, and reducing body bulk. The body becomes more toned and aligned, leading to a more natural, graceful physique.

As you practice yoga, you’ll learn how to properly align your muscles in every pose. This process helps to avoid injury while strengthening and toning muscles. Unlike traditional gym workouts, yoga gently stimulates your joints with plenty of oxygen, aiding in the release of tension and improving mobility.

Yoga also encourages a deep connection to your breath, which helps oxygenate your joints and muscles. Your yoga instructors will guide you through each pose, helping you push your limits safely and effectively. As you continue to practice, you’ll begin to see how yoga reshapes your body, improving both its strength and flexibility.

Balance and Mobility Through Yoga

One of the often-overlooked benefits of yoga is its ability to improve balance and mobility. As we age, our bodies naturally become stiffer, our joints lose flexibility, and muscle mass begins to decrease. Yoga helps combat these changes by promoting joint flexibility, muscle strength, and balance.

By practicing yoga regularly, you’ll improve your body’s mobility and maintain better balance, both physically and mentally. The mindfulness incorporated in each yoga session helps you connect with your body in a way that enhances its overall function and health.
